Transaction 3705fd0360da1118a9730d967f7e6333ee57e0847f976b6475bf984926106e2a

2 Input
2 Outputs
  • 3705fd0360da1118a9730d967f7e6333ee57e0847f976b6475bf984926106e2a:0
  • value  2841258
    address  1CbSmGRdUm8kgxMxPfo2VJnjFAJo9bNbY1
  • 3705fd0360da1118a9730d967f7e6333ee57e0847f976b6475bf984926106e2a:1
  • value  17735432
    address  3ACBAe9aiDDB9yFHYCGLPW7XLeojtKWFwh